#f78388 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f78388 is composed of 96.9% red, 51.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 357.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 74.1%. #f78388 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ef0711.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#f78388 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f78388 has RGB values of R:247, G:131,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.45,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16221064.

Shades and Tints of #f78388
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fef2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f78388
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fbbbb is the less saturated color, while #fc7e83 is the most saturated one.
